Hi
I can backup a shared folder from my Win7 64 PC to DNS-327L without problems.
My Local Backup setup is:
Lan backup
Account
User name and password that matches a win7 user and password account
with read access permissions to the shared folder
Folder type
url like \\x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x\Win7_shared_folder where x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x is my win7 lan ip
(testing gives test result successful and file size unavailable)
save to Volume_1/BackupFolder/
date and time
no incremental backup
At the date and time scheduled the backup is performed without problems.

;D YES! PC backup to DNS-327L using anonymous log in SOLVED! ;D
The folder that you want to backup, right-click/share with/specific people...ADD Guest with read/write permission (I believe DLink uses Guest as the anonymous log in). Click Share.
Next, go to Advance share settings. Select Turn off password protected sharing. Now, the part I was missing, REBOOT! Daggum Windows! I guess you have to reboot to reconfigure Windows to turn off password protected sharing.
